Two Katten attorneys will participate in the FIA Law & Compliance Division Conference on Wednesday, October 7–Friday, October 9.

Gary DeWaal, special counsel in the Financial Markets and Funds practice, will moderate the "Fintech and Advanced Crypto Issues for Non-Techies (and Techies too)" discussion at 9:30 a.m. (ET) on Thursday, October 8. The panel will explore innovations in fintech and their legal and compliance implications, considering the application of artificial intelligence including robo advisors in the derivatives space, blockchain applications to support businesses other than for bitcoin trading, and analytic issues around the use of crypto assets other than bitcoin, such as stablecoins and virtual assets that represent securities.

Carl Kennedy, partner in the Financial Markets and Funds practice, will participate in the "Ethics" panel at 9:30 a.m. (ET) on Friday, October 9. The panel will explore potential ethical issues associated with events in 2020 from the perspective of attorneys representing participants in the futures and swaps markets. Speakers will discuss topics including ethical issues that might arise from remote working environments and other pandemic-related changes in business functions, from current events in society at large, and from situations described in recent CFTC enforcement actions.
